Do it like this...

And no, extruding is not the only way to create a surface. You should only use it in certain situations when the continuity of the splines is garantied.

 

The short-version:

1.) Patches must be created from 3, 4 or 5-CPs.

2.) Patches must contain of at least 2 splines, which are connected.

3.) 5-Point-Patches have to be created by selecting 5 CPs (see the image how they should be placed) and clicking on the Make 5-Point-Patch-Button (see the image.)

Why not implement a button to make any amount of cps a patch instead of just five?? Funny number

 

A patch is like a surface stretched between *two* pairs of rails like in largento's right-side drawing. That's the situation where the math can be made to work predictably and quickly.

 

A three point patch is really like a four point patch where two opposite rails happen to converge at the same point.

 

Five point patches are a special Hash-only phenomenon. NURBS can't do it. It was regarded as impossible, sort of like finding a new whole number between 1 and 2 is impossible. Martin actually got written up in a math journal for inventing the thing. A five point patch is really subdivided into four-point patches and a center "CP" is manufactured out of nowhere to hold it together.

 

I suppose they could make any number of sides subdivide themselves, but there is no mesh situation that requires a more than 5 sided patch and you're better off subdividing your n-sided shape yourself so you control where the curves are.

You can close the ends of your box a couple of ways. The easiest way is to create a new spline from one corner to the opposite corner - be sure you attach the CPs in the new spline to the CPs in the existing square.

Another way is to 1) select all the CPs in the spline ring that defines the open end of the box 2) switch to side view 3)hit the Extrude button 4)scale and translate to newly created CPs until the hole is no longer visible.

Another way is to insert a CP halfway up each of the vertical splines in your picture. Then connect the CPs with a new spline.

Where the splines intersect, are the CP's "welded" together, or are they just next to each other?

 

In the view from the front(Num Pad 2), it looks like these CP's are connected. but when viewed from the top (Num Pad 5) you can see that they are not actually "welded" together. therefore they will not make a patch.

Okay, your example is one spline ring with additional splines coming out of that one. Not sure why this isn't getting across, but a single spline ring makes a *hole* NOT a patch.

 

In Myron's example, there are four splines. Two vertical and two horizontal. They are attached at the four CPs, forming a patch. Try this: Make a vertical spline with four CPs. One at each end and two in the center. Copy and paste it and move it over to the side, so that you have two identical vertical splines.

 

Now, click the "a" button to begin making a new horizontal spine and then click on the CPs of the two vertical splines as you draw your horizontal spline. Repeat this for the second horizontal spline.
